TensorFlow:

A popular open-source machine learning framework developed by Google that is widely used for deep learning and neural network applications.

One of the key features of TensorFlow is its ability to handle large-scale, complex neural networks. It provides a wide range of pre-built tools and libraries that make it easy to build and train models, as well as tools for data management and visualization. TensorFlow also includes support for distributed computing, which allows users to train models on multiple machines simultaneously for faster processing times.

In addition to its powerful machine learning capabilities, TensorFlow has also become popular for its ease of use and versatility. It supports multiple programming languages, including Python, C++, and Java, and can be run on a variety of platforms, including desktop computers, mobile devices, and cloud servers. This makes it accessible to a wide range of users, from hobbyists and students to professional developers and researchers.

PyTorch:

Another popular open-source machine learning framework, developed by Facebook, that offers dynamic computation graphs and an intuitive interface for building and training machine learning models. PyTorch is known for its flexibility and ease of use, as well as its support for a wide range of neural network architectures and optimization techniques.

Keras:

A high-level neural network API written in Python that offers a user-friendly interface for building and training machine learning models. Keras is designed to be easy to use and flexible, with support for a wide range of neural network architectures and optimization techniques.

Amazon SageMaker:

A cloud-based machine learning platform that offers tools for building, training, and deploying machine learning models. SageMaker provides a range of pre-built algorithms and frameworks, as well as tools for data preparation, model deployment, and collaboration features.

IBM Watson Studio:

A cloud-based platform that provides tools for building and training machine learning models, as well as data preparation, model deployment, and collaboration features. Watson Studio is designed to be easy to use and accessible to a wide range of users, with support for multiple programming languages and data formats.

Microsoft Azure Machine Learning Studio:

A cloud-based platform that provides a wide range of tools for building, training, and deploying machine learning models, as well as data preparation, model management, and collaboration features. Azure Machine Learning Studio is designed to be flexible and scalable, with support for a wide range of machine learning algorithms and frameworks.

H2O.ai:

An open-source machine learning platform that offers tools for building and training machine learning models, as well as automated machine learning features and model explainability. H2O.ai is known for its ease of use and support for a wide range of data formats and algorithms.

DataRobot:

An automated machine learning platform that uses AI algorithms to automatically build and deploy machine learning models. DataRobot is designed to be easy to use and accessible to a wide range of users, with support for multiple programming languages and data formats.

Caffe:

A deep learning framework developed by Berkeley AI Research (BAIR) that is widely used for computer vision applications. Caffe is known for its speed and efficiency, as well as its support for a wide range of neural network architectures and optimization techniques.

Theano:

An open-source numerical computation library that is widely used for deep learning and neural network applications. Theano is known for its speed and efficiency, as well as its support for a wide range of machine-learning algorithms and optimization techniques.
